Проблема при смене хостинга

Статус
В этой теме нельзя размещать новые ответы.

Blef

Проверенные
Сообщения
197
Реакции
58
Баллы
11,030
Вечер добрый.
Возникла проблема при смене хостинга.
Суть в следующем: на первом хостинге, все файлы форума грузились в корневую папку "домен.ru", у нового корневая папка находится по адресу: домен.ru/public_html/

Поддержка пишет: "Измените пути к файлам у вашего сайта. ""переменные прописаны где-то в конфигах сайта. "
Вопрос как правильно сделать и как эта ситуация повлияет на выдачу в поиске?
 
переменные прописаны где-то в конфигах сайта
xenforo работает с относительными путями, ему пофиг куда его ложить. Если конечно не прописано в /library/config.php и файлы движка никто не трогал
 
Не могу загрузить дамп базы, думаю по этой причине.
Путь грузит

В логах масса ошибок из-за этого "No such file or directory"
Виртуальный хостинг или vds? Если первое - то все вопросы либо уже написаны на сайте хостинга в ЧаВо либо это разруливает техподдержка по тикетам.
 
Последнее редактирование:
Поддержка пишет:
Рекомендуем проверить целостность файлов сайта. )

Путь грузит



Виртуальный хостинг или vds? Если первое - то все вопросы либо уже написаны на сайте хостинга в ЧаВо либо это разруливает техподдержка по тикетам.
vds
 
Последнее редактирование модератором:
Но перед этим сделал за них часть работы.
Дорогие учёные. У меня который год в подполе происходит подземный стук. Объясните, пожалуйста, как он происходит
 
Я добавил домен, загрузил файлы, создал базу, при импорте дампа минуту идёт процесс и всё... база пустая.

При обращении к папке install, запускается процесс минуя папку public_html.
Потом появляется ошибка
Server Error
cache_dir must be a directory

В конфиге путь прописывал.
 
Попроси их перенести и не заморачивайся
Попросил. В итоге здесь тему создал.)

Причина ошибки была в пути к папке cache_dir.
Дамп залили, теперь следующая проблема: открывается только главная страница, на всех остальных 404 ошибка.
Проблема в htaccess?
 
Последнее редактирование модератором:
Явно не в конфиг форума, а в конфиг nginx на сервере.
Я же не знаю, какая у Вас связка там используется, и если файл - htaccess, присутствует в каталоге форума, то либо он некорректен, либо форум работает под управлением nginx + php-fpm (да, я помню, что есть ещё варианты).
Что у Вас здесь - /admin.php?tools/phpinfo.
 
System Linux vm443606.had.su 4.9.0-8-amd64 #1 SMP Debian 4.9.130-2 (2018-10-27) x86_64
Build Date Jun 14 2018 13:50:25
Server API FPM/FastCGI
Virtual Directory Support disabled
Configuration File (php.ini) Path /etc/php/7.0/fpm
Loaded Configuration File /etc/php/7.0/fpm/php.ini
Scan this dir for additional .ini files /etc/php/7.0/fpm/conf.d
Additional .ini files parsed /etc/php/7.0/fpm/conf.d/10-mysqlnd.ini, /etc/php/7.0/fpm/conf.d/10-opcache.ini, /etc/php/7.0/fpm/conf.d/10-pdo.ini, /etc/php/7.0/fpm/conf.d/15-xml.ini, /etc/php/7.0/fpm/conf.d/20-bz2.ini, /etc/php/7.0/fpm/conf.d/20-calendar.ini, /etc/php/7.0/fpm/conf.d/20-ctype.ini, /etc/php/7.0/fpm/conf.d/20-curl.ini, /etc/php/7.0/fpm/conf.d/20-dom.ini, /etc/php/7.0/fpm/conf.d/20-exif.ini, /etc/php/7.0/fpm/conf.d/20-fileinfo.ini, /etc/php/7.0/fpm/conf.d/20-ftp.ini, /etc/php/7.0/fpm/conf.d/20-gd.ini, /etc/php/7.0/fpm/conf.d/20-gettext.ini, /etc/php/7.0/fpm/conf.d/20-iconv.ini, /etc/php/7.0/fpm/conf.d/20-intl.ini, /etc/php/7.0/fpm/conf.d/20-json.ini, /etc/php/7.0/fpm/conf.d/20-mbstring.ini, /etc/php/7.0/fpm/conf.d/20-mcrypt.ini, /etc/php/7.0/fpm/conf.d/20-mysqli.ini, /etc/php/7.0/fpm/conf.d/20-pdo_mysql.ini, /etc/php/7.0/fpm/conf.d/20-phar.ini, /etc/php/7.0/fpm/conf.d/20-posix.ini, /etc/php/7.0/fpm/conf.d/20-pspell.ini, /etc/php/7.0/fpm/conf.d/20-readline.ini, /etc/php/7.0/fpm/conf.d/20-shmop.ini, /etc/php/7.0/fpm/conf.d/20-simplexml.ini, /etc/php/7.0/fpm/conf.d/20-sockets.ini, /etc/php/7.0/fpm/conf.d/20-sysvmsg.ini, /etc/php/7.0/fpm/conf.d/20-sysvsem.ini, /etc/php/7.0/fpm/conf.d/20-sysvshm.ini, /etc/php/7.0/fpm/conf.d/20-tokenizer.ini, /etc/php/7.0/fpm/conf.d/20-wddx.ini, /etc/php/7.0/fpm/conf.d/20-xmlreader.ini, /etc/php/7.0/fpm/conf.d/20-xmlwriter.ini, /etc/php/7.0/fpm/conf.d/20-xsl.ini, /etc/php/7.0/fpm/conf.d/20-zip.ini
PHP API 20151012
PHP Extension 20151012
Zend Extension 320151012
Zend Extension Build API320151012,NTS
PHP Extension Build API20151012,NTS
Debug Build no
Thread Safety disabled
Zend Signal Handling disabled
Zend Memory Manager enabled
Zend Multibyte Support provided by mbstring
IPv6 Support enabled
DTrace Support available, disabled
Registered PHP Streamshttps, ftps, compress.zlib, php, file, glob, data, http, ftp, compress.bzip2, phar, zip
Registered Stream Socket Transportstcp, udp, unix, udg, ssl, sslv2, tls, tlsv1.0, tlsv1.1, tlsv1.2
Registered Stream Filterszlib., string.rot13, string.toupper, string.tolower, string.strip_tags, convert., consumed, dechunk, bzip2., convert.iconv., mcrypt., mdecrypt.
 
Техподдержка добавила этот код, теперь и главная выдаёт 404.

Nginx
Для активации ЧПУ на Nginx серверах добавьте следующий код в конфигурационный файл своего сервера:

Код:

location /xf/ {
try_files $uri $uri/ /xf/index.php?$uri&$args;
index index.php index.html;
}

location /xf/internal_data/ {
internal;
}
location /xf/library/ {
internal;
}

location ~ \.php$ {
try_files $uri =404;
fastcgi_pass 127.0.0.1:9000;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params;
}

Не забудьте поменять /xf/ на путь до Вашей папки с установленным форумом.
 
Статус
В этой теме нельзя размещать новые ответы.
Современный облачный хостинг провайдер | Aéza
Назад
Сверху Снизу